"LES ETOILES" RESTAURANT and the ATLANTE HOTEL in ROME..A MUST VISIT..EASILY 5 STARS by PHILIP S. KAMPE

Before returning to America after a weeks visit to the DOMODIMONTI Vineyards in Le Marche, I had the opportunity to visit Rome, thanks to the ITALIAN GOVERNMENT TOURIST BOARD (www.ItalianTourism.com )and was introduced to "The BEST PLACE TO SEE ROME", the ATLANTE GARDEN HOTEL.

The Atlante Graden Hotel is one of the few hotels in Rome that offers FREE pick-up service from Rome's main airport, Fumicino Leonardo Da Vinci. With tip, you save 50 euros for a taxi and the headache that is always reserved for overseas airport arrivals.

But, I am not writing about the Hotel Atlante Garden, located near the near the Vatican, which can be found at http://www.atlantehotels.com/ .

I am writing to PRAISE the Unique and Spectactular 360 degree Panoramic View from the Roof Garden Restaurant and the Dining Room on the Top Floor of the Hotel. The view is unmatched at the Restaurant, LES ETOILES, as well as the food.

I met the owner, Roberta, while dining and realized that I had found a restaurant and an owner with true conviction for the "Finest Food in Rome". Couple that with a Wine List that exceeds expectation.

I asked the Wine Steward to choose a wine for the meal, since courses ranged from pasta with swordfish ragu, which I ordered, to steak and grilled pream. He chose a wonderful PINOT NERO, which was a Perfect choice.

Of course, the meal was started with a bottle of Proseco Valdobbiadene and selected antipasto.
